Site icon PIECE — WITHIN NIGERIA

Tips for Landing a Job in the Tech Industry

Tips for Landing a Job in the Tech Industry

Landing a Job in the Tech Industry

The tech industry is buzzing with innovation, thanks to giants like Apple, NVIDIA, and Google. It’s full of exciting opportunities, making it a great place to work. But, finding a job here can be tough.

To win, you must know the job market well. You should also be ready to try different ways to find work. The tech world offers many jobs, not just coding and development. Roles like sales, HR, and more are also available. By looking at all these options, you can boost your chances.

Whether you’re experienced or new to the field, finding a job in tech needs a smart plan. Being flexible and focused will keep you ahead.

The Current Tech Job Market

To succeed in tech, you must grasp the job market trends and opportunities. The tech job market is always changing. Different factors affect the number of jobs and the skills needed.

Remote Work Opportunities and Challenges

Remote work is big in tech. It brings flexibility and a wider talent pool. But, it also has challenges like keeping communication and teamwork strong.

Impact of AI and Automation on Tech Roles

AI and automation are changing tech, automating simple tasks. They also open up new jobs that need special skills.

Technical Skills Worth Investing In

To stay ahead, focus on in-demand skills. Some key ones are:

Emerging Specializations with Growth Potentials

Some specializations are growing fast. Think about getting into:

Knowing these trends helps you navigate the tech job market. It guides your career choices.

Building a Competitive Tech Resume

A competitive tech resume does more than list your job duties. It shows your impact and achievements. To stand out, your resume must highlight your skills, experience, and value to employers.

Hiring managers look for more than job history. They want to see your impact, the tech you used, and your contributions. This helps them understand your worth.

Creating a Skills Matrix

A skills matrix is a great way to showcase your technical skills. It categorizes your abilities in areas like programming languages and software proficiency. This makes it easy for hiring managers to see your strengths.

It also helps your resume pass through applicant tracking systems (ATS). This increases your chances of catching a hiring manager’s eye.

Quantifying Your Technical Achievements

Quantifying your achievements means using numbers to show your impact. Instead of saying “improved application performance,” say “enhanced application performance by 30%.” This clearly shows your accomplishments.

It also demonstrates what you can achieve for a new employer.

Describing Project Impact and Results

Describing your project outcomes is key. Talk about the results of your work, like “successfully deployed a cloud-based solution that reduced infrastructure costs by 25%.” This shows your technical skills and ability to drive results.

Highlighting Collaborative Work

In tech, teamwork is essential. Show your ability to work well with others by highlighting team projects and leadership roles. Use phrases like “collaborated with a team of 5 to develop a new software feature” to showcase your teamwork.

By using these strategies, you can boost your chances of getting a tech job. Remember, your resume is often your first chance to impress. Make it count by showing your skills, achievements, and teamwork.

Developing Your Online Presence

As you look for tech jobs, a strong online presence can really help. Today, your online image is often the first thing employers see. It’s your chance to make a good first impression.

Having a professional website is key. It’s like a digital portfolio that shows off your skills and work. Make sure it’s easy to use, looks good, and is easy for search engines to find.

Your LinkedIn profile is also important. It should be full, up-to-date, and show off your tech skills. Join in on discussions, share interesting content, and connect with others in your field.

To really stand out online, follow these tips:

Building a strong online presence can make you more visible to employers. It’s a key part of finding a job in tech. A solid online foundation is often the start of a successful job search.

Effective Strategies for Landing a Job in the Tech Industry

Getting a job in tech needs more than just applying online. It’s key to connect with employers and industry pros through different ways.

Virtual Networking Events and Hackathons

Virtual events and hackathons are key for meeting industry folks and showing off your skills. Taking part in these can help you make real connections and show what you can do to employers.

Building Meaningful Industry Connections

It’s important to make connections in your field. Go to conferences, join online forums, and talk in groups to show you’re there. These connections can lead to job referrals, a big way companies find new hires.

Working with Tech-Specialized Recruiters

Tech recruiters know the job market well and can find jobs that fit you. They often have good ties with top tech firms, helping you in your job hunt.

Optimizing Your Profiles on Tech Job Boards

Having a pro profile on tech job sites can make you more visible to employers. Make sure your profile is full, current, and shows off your tech skills and experience.

Let’s look at how these strategies can help:

Strategy Benefits Potential Outcomes
Virtual Networking Events Connect with industry professionals, showcase skills Job opportunities, referrals
Building Industry Connections Establish presence, build relationships Referrals, job offers
Working with Tech-Specialized Recruiters Access to job market knowledge, connections with top tech companies Job placements, career growth opportunities
Optimizing Profiles on Tech Job Boards Enhanced visibility, showing off skills and experience Job offers, more visibility to employers

Using these strategies can really boost your chances of getting a tech job.

Mastering the Tech Interview Process

Getting a job in tech means mastering the interview process. It’s all about being ready, confident, and showing off your skills. You need to fit the role perfectly.

Practicing Coding Challenges

Working on coding challenges is key. Sites like LeetCode, HackerRank, and CodeWars have lots of problems. They help you get better at coding and solving problems.

Doing these challenges often makes you more confident. You’ll be ready to handle coding questions in the interview.

System Design Interview Preparation

System design interviews are important. To get ready, focus on making systems that work well and are easy to use. Learn common design patterns and practice explaining your choices.

Be ready to talk about the trade-offs you make. This will help you explain your ideas clearly during the interview.

Using the STAR Method Effectively

The STAR method helps with behavioral questions. It stands for Situation, Task, Action, Result. Use it to structure your answers.

Describe the situation, the task, what you did, and the outcome. This makes your answers clear and effective.

Demonstrating Cultural Fit

Showing you fit the company’s culture is important. Learn about the company’s values and how you match them. Talk about your teamwork skills and ability to adapt.

This shows you’re a good fit for the team. It’s a key part of being a strong candidate.

What to Expect at Each Stage

Knowing the interview stages helps you prepare better. The process usually starts with a screening, then technical interviews, and ends with a final interview.

Understanding each stage helps you focus your preparation. It makes you more ready for what’s coming.

Following Up Appropriately

Don’t forget to follow up after an interview. A thank-you note or email shows you’re grateful and interested. It leaves a good impression.

It keeps you in the interviewer’s mind. This is an important step many candidates miss.

Exit mobile version